The lean condition is maybe one pilot jet restricted . As you close the throttle the slides drop down. With one carb lean in the lower midrange the engine speeds up a little before going down to the idle circuit. Pilots are very small orifice. If you can't get it . Replace the jets with new ones . But try to synchronize the carbs first. Don't forget to uncover the idle screws if it has not been done already
